S.201

Requires DEP to adopt rules and regulations establishing alternative provisions by which vehicle manufacturers may comply with Low Emission Vehicle program.

New Jersey S201 mandates the Department of Environmental Protection to create rules for an alternative compliance program for vehicle manufacturers.

New Jersey S201 requires the Department of Environmental Protection to adopt rules and regulations establishing an Interim Alternative ZEV Compliance Program. This program provides vehicle manufacturers with alternative compliance options for the state's Low Emission Vehicle program. Manufacturers can comply by offering a portfolio of zero-emission vehicles to New Jersey dealers, up to the number of vehicles ordered by consumers. The bill specifies that manufacturers complying with this program are exempt from penalties for noncompliance with zero-emission vehicle sales quotas.
